Frank Sinatra and Elvis Presley had it wrong. Doing it "my way" is nothing to be proud of. In fact, instead of bringing the promised contentment, pursuing our own fancies only leads to dissatisfaction, resentment, and a lot of hurt. As Christians, however, we are fortunate. We serve the God of second chances. Even when we miss the mark, He doesn't write us off. Sure, consequences often follow. But our God is loving, gracious, and anxious to help. Surprised by God is all about getting that second chance. It's there for the asking. I know. I've received it, and blessings beyond my wildest dreams. Surprise! You can start over! There's a story in the New Testament about a prodigal son, a tale Stephen Arterburn knows well. He lived it, in fact. But when the chips were down and he was surrounded by pig slop, he had but one desire: to return to his Heavenly Father. And it was then that he was Surprised by God.
